What Is Ambient Listen Triage?
Ambient listening in healthcare refers to AI systems that continuously process spoken conversation between clinicians and patients without requiring manual input. When applied specifically to triage, these systems do far more than transcribe — they interpret symptom language, extract acuity signals, flag red-flag keywords, and structure data for clinical decision support tools, all in real time. Unlike traditional scribes or voice dictation tools, ambient listen triage operates passively and contextually.
The Numbers Behind the Need
The clinical and operational evidence for ambient listen triage is growing rapidly. Key metrics from recent peer-reviewed studies include a 13.4% increase in patients seen per shift with ambient voice technology (NHS London ED, 2024–25), a 51.7% reduction in time to first documentation (NHS evaluation, 2025), and a 7.5% reduction in time from clinician assignment to patient readiness (SSRN / York Health Economics Consortium, 2025).
How It Works in the ED
When a patient arrives at the ED, a small device begins listening — with patient consent — as the triage nurse conducts the initial assessment. The ambient AI system transcribes the conversation, extracts structured clinical data, maps to acuity scores (ESI, CTAS, or MTS), populates the EHR automatically, and generates escalation alerts when critical keywords are detected. All of this happens while the clinician remains fully focused on the patient.
Triage Equity: Closing the Gap
A landmark 2024 study in the Annals of Emergency Medicine found that conventional triage is strongly associated with biased decision-making across race, ethnicity, and spoken language. Ambient AI triage changes the equation: by standardizing data capture regardless of how a patient communicates, AI-informed decision support measurably reduces under-triage disparities and ensures consistent acuity scoring across patient demographics.
